MOON HALL SCHOOLS EDUCATIONAL TRUST
Activities
As described by the charity on the register
The promotion and provision of advancement of education, particularly for dyslexic children. The Trust runs a school in Surrey which specialises in teaching dyslexic children. The school is primary and secondary up to Year 11 and GCSE and provides a full mainstream curriculum including a range of extra-curricular activities.
